Lutz: Chevy Orlando coming, could get Voltec powertrain

Before General Motors' financial woes got so out-of-hand that the giant automaker was forced to declare bankruptcy, plans were in place to bring the Chevrolet Orlando, a new seven-passenger multi-purpose vehicle, to the U.S. market in 2011. First seen at the Paris Motor Show last year, the Orlando concept was a modern take on the nearly defunct but extremely useful wagon shape that seemed destined to replace the retrotastic HHR in GM's lineup.
